Validation of HTTP response time from network traffic as an alternative to web browser instrumentation
dc.contributor.author | López Romera, Carlos | |
dc.contributor.author | Morató Osés, Daniel | |
dc.contributor.author | Magaña Lizarrondo, Eduardo | |
dc.contributor.author | Izal Azcárate, Mikel | |
dc.contributor.department | Ingeniaritza Elektrikoa, Elektronikoaren eta Telekomunikazio Ingeniaritzaren | eu |
dc.contributor.department | Institute of Smart Cities - ISC | en |
dc.contributor.department | Ingeniería Eléctrica, Electrónica y de Comunicación | es_ES |
dc.date.accessioned | 2021-12-09T12:25:16Z | |
dc.date.available | 2022-10-20T23:00:13Z | |
dc.date.issued | 2021 | |
dc.description.abstract | The measurement of response time in hypertext transfer protocol (HTTP) requests is the most basic proxy measurement method for evaluating web browsing quality. It is used in the research literature and in application performance measurement instruments. During the development of a website, response time is obtained from in-browser measurements. After the website has been deployed, network traffic is used to continuously monitor activity, and the measurement data are used for service management and planning. In this study, we evaluate the accuracy of the measurements obtained from network traffic by comparing them with the in-browser measurement of resource load time. We evaluate the response times for encrypted and clear-text requests in an emulated network environment, in a laboratory deployment equivalent to a data centre network, and accessing popular web sites on the public Internet. The accuracy for response time measurements obtained from network traffic is noticeable higher for Internet long distance paths than for lowdelay paths (below 20 ms round-trip). The overhead of traffic encryption in secure HTTP requests has a negative effect on measurement accuracy, and we find relative measurement errors higher than 70% when using network traffic to infer HTTP response times compared | en |
dc.description.sponsorship | This work was supported by the Spanish State Agency of Research through project PID2019-104451RB-C22/AEI/10.13039/501100011033 | en |
dc.embargo.lift | 2022-10-20 | |
dc.embargo.terms | 2022-10-20 | |
dc.format.extent | 15 p. | |
dc.format.mimetype | application/pdf | en |
dc.identifier.citation | C. López, D. Morato, E. Magaña and M. Izal, 'Validation of HTTP Response Time from Network Traffic as an Alternative to Web Browser Instrumentation,' in IEEE Transactions on Network and Service Management, doi: 10.1109/TNSM.2021.3121468. | en |
dc.identifier.doi | 10.1109/TNSM.2021.3121468 | |
dc.identifier.issn | 1932-4537 (Electronic) | |
dc.identifier.uri | https://academica-e.unavarra.es/handle/2454/41209 | |
dc.language.iso | eng | en |
dc.publisher | IEEE | en |
dc.relation.ispartof | IEEE Transactions on Network and Service Management | en |
dc.relation.projectID | info:eu-repo/grantAgreement/AEI/Plan Estatal de Investigación Científica y Técnica y de Innovación 2017-2020/PID2019-104451RB-C22/ES/ | |
dc.relation.publisherversion | https://doi.org/10.1109/TNSM.2021.3121468 | |
dc.rights | © 2021 IEEE. Personal use of this material is permitted. Permission from IEEE must be obtained for all other uses, in any current or future media, including reprinting/republishing this material for advertising or promotional purposes, creating new collective works, for resale or redistribution to servers or lists, or reuse of any copyrighted component of this work in other work. | en |
dc.rights.accessRights | info:eu-repo/semantics/openAccess | |
dc.subject | HTTP response time | en |
dc.subject | Traffic measurement | en |
dc.subject | Service monitoring | en |
dc.title | Validation of HTTP response time from network traffic as an alternative to web browser instrumentation | en |
dc.type | info:eu-repo/semantics/article | |
dc.type.version | info:eu-repo/semantics/acceptedVersion | |
dspace.entity.type | Publication | |
relation.isAuthorOfPublication | 729a384b-dd17-4e0b-91f5-cb884fce34cb | |
relation.isAuthorOfPublication | cd454059-725e-480a-b896-894e79f307a5 | |
relation.isAuthorOfPublication | c521bf55-a1e7-47b2-ac98-5fbf8c286f7a | |
relation.isAuthorOfPublication | f829a159-0938-45d1-a352-d28fb297ed0b | |
relation.isAuthorOfPublication.latestForDiscovery | 729a384b-dd17-4e0b-91f5-cb884fce34cb |